About

Türk Telekom Group is Turkey's world-class, first and largest integrated telecom operator offering its customers the complete range of mobile, broadband, data, TV and fixed voice services as well as innovative convergence technologies. Türk Telekom continues to provide value to Turkey with “accessible communication for all” principle throughout its more than 180 years of history, while making its stakeholders feel they are esteemed.

Shaping its operations in line with its “Not just for some, but for everyone” service approach, Türk Telekom is committed to delivering the most recent and advanced communication technologies with the best in class customer experience to all its subscribers; from a single person living in the most remote part of the country to crowded families; from the smallest companies to the largest enterprises.

Türk Telekom Group Companies provide services in all 81 provinces of Turkey with the vision of introducing new technologies to Turkey and accelerating Turkey’s transformation into an information society. Turkey is one of the largest telecom markets in EMEA region with about 85 million growing population and increasing number of households.

Türk Telekom privatized in 2005 and IPO'ed in 2008, underwent a successful transformation resulting in increased efficiency and enlarged scope of services.

In 2015, Türk Telekom adopted a “customer-oriented” and integrated structure in order to respond to the rapidly changing communication and technology needs of customers in the most powerful and accurate way. Having a wide service network and product range in the fields of individual and corporate services, Türk Telekom unified its mobile, internet, phone and TV products and services under the single “Türk Telekom” brand as of January 2016.

In line with its vision of enriching the business and lives of its customers and strengthening its position of being Turkey’s leading communication infrastructure and solution provider by doing the best in every field, Türk Telekom defines its strategic goals around two main focus areas in terms of growth and efficiency in core and non-core telco activities.

Türk Telekom aims to increase internet penetration through its strategy of expanding the fixed broadband market. In the mobile market, it aims to increase its subscriber and revenue market share with its synergy offerings through its strong fiber cable infrastructure and its range of mobile frequencies, and its wireless household synergy offers.  The Company also aims to increase the penetration rate in the Pay TV market with its extensive investments in fixed broadband, extensive platform options such as IPTV, satellite and Web/Smart TV, and an extensive range of content.

The expansion of the fiber infrastructure is important for the development of the country and the industry, and also for supporting 5G and next generation technologies. Therefore, as the leading telecommunications company which establishes and develops Turkey’s communication backbone, Türk Telekom approaches the development of the fiber infrastructure with a special sensitivity. For the last 10 years, Türk Telekom have accelerated the expansion of its fiber network, a process which will contribute to Turkey’s digital transformation and provide the fixed infrastructure for 5G technology.
